As of May 18, 2021, the average annual salary for Chief Engineer in Montana is $276,424, equivalent to $133 per hour, $5,316 weekly, or $23,035 monthly. These figures, sourced from Salary.com’s real-time job posting scans, highlight competitive earning potential for Chief Engineer in cities like Santa Clara, San Jose, and Fremont.

Annually Salaries for Chief Engineer in Montana vary widely, spanning from $226,795 to $308,664. Most professionals fall between the 25th percentile ($250,446) and 75th percentile ($293,300), while top earners (90th percentile) make $308,664 per year. What is a Chief Engineer ?

A chief engineer, commonly referred to as "ChEng" or "Chief", is the seniormost engine officer of an engine department on a ship, typically a merchant ship, and holds overall leadership and responsibility of that department. As a person who holds one of the most senior roles on the ship, he or she must have excellent communication and leadership skills. He or she will be expected to regularly work alongside other crew members and external consultants, and most importantly, provide guidance his or her team.
